Daily Responsibilities and Job Details

As a real estate lawyer, you will work in a private practice environment focused primarily on residential property matters. Each workday brings you in direct contact with a variety of real estate cases, where your expertise is essential.

You will handle contract drafting, title reviews, and facilitate property transactions from start to finish. Being a member of the Canadian Bar Association is mandatory, ensuring a high standard of professionalism and compliance.

The job does not offer remote options, which fosters greater collaboration and mentorship on-site. This is ideal if you prefer direct interaction with colleagues and clients while building your professional network.

Previous experience of two to three years in real estate law is required, making this suitable for lawyers with early career experience and looking to grow further.
